返回

# VSCode插件Error Lens:实时捕捉代码错误,助你轻松保持代码清洁! #

前端

Error Lens:实时捕捉代码错误,助你轻松保持代码整洁

代码质量的守护者

作为程序员,我们在编写代码时不可避免地会犯下错误。但这些错误往往会对代码质量造成严重影响,导致代码无法正常工作,甚至带来灾难性的后果。为了避免此类情况的发生,我们需要一种工具来帮助我们及时发现并修复代码中的错误。Error Lens正是为此而生的。

实时错误检测,从源头杜绝问题

Error Lens的强大之处在于其实时错误检测功能。它就像一位代码卫士,在你编写代码的同时,实时扫描代码并识别各种问题,包括:

  • 语法错误:识别未闭合的括号、引号等代码语法错误。
  • 逻辑错误:检测条件判断错误、循环控制错误等代码逻辑错误。
  • 可疑代码:识别代码中的可疑代码段,如不必要的重复代码、死代码等。
  • 潜在问题:标记代码中可能存在的问题,如未使用变量、未初始化变量等。

通过Error Lens的实时检测,你可以立即发现并修复代码中的问题,确保代码从源头开始就保持整洁。

全面覆盖,无处遁形

Error Lens覆盖了多种错误类型,确保代码中的问题无处遁形。

Error Lens支持多种错误类型的检测,包括:

- 语法错误:识别代码中的语法错误,如未闭合的括号、引号等。
- 逻辑错误:检测代码中的逻辑错误,如条件判断错误、循环控制错误等。
- 可疑代码:识别代码中可疑的代码段,如不必要的重复代码、死代码等。
- 潜在问题:标记代码中可能存在的问题,如未使用变量、未初始化变量等。

代码审查和调试的利器

Error Lens不仅可以帮助你编写出高质量的代码,还可以作为代码审查和调试的利器。

代码审查 :Error Lens使代码审查变得更加高效和准确,代码审查人员可以快速识别代码中的错误和问题。

调试 :Error Lens可以快速定位代码中的错误位置,缩短调试时间,提高调试效率。

个性化定制,打造专属错误检测工具

Error Lens还提供了强大的扩展性。你可以编写自定义规则来扩展其错误检测功能。这让你可以根据自己的项目和编码习惯,打造出个性化的错误检测工具。

安装简便,使用轻松

安装Error Lens插件非常简单,你可以在VSCode的扩展商店中搜索并安装它。安装完成后,Error Lens会自动扫描你的代码并识别其中的问题。你可以在Error Lens面板中查看这些问题,并根据需要进行修复。

常见问题解答

  1. Error Lens是否免费?
    是的,Error Lens是一个免费且开源的VSCode插件。

  2. Error Lens是否支持其他编程语言?
    目前,Error Lens主要支持JavaScript、TypeScript、Python、Java和C#。

  3. 如何编写自定义规则?
    你可以查看Error Lens文档,了解如何编写自定义规则。

  4. Error Lens会影响代码性能吗?
    Error Lens对代码性能的影响很小,不会对你的开发体验造成显著影响。

  5. 如何联系Error Lens的开发团队?
    你可以在GitHub上找到Error Lens的开发团队,并通过提交问题或加入讨论组来联系他们。

结论

VSCode插件Error Lens是一款功能强大、使用方便的实时错误检测工具。它可以帮助你轻松发现代码中的各种问题,包括语法错误、逻辑错误、可疑代码等。通过Error Lens,你可以随时掌握代码质量,提高开发效率,让代码审查和调试变得更加轻松。如果你是一位程序员,那么Error Lens绝对是你的必备工具。